C语言计算程序中某一个函数或算法的执行时间

Posted

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了C语言计算程序中某一个函数或算法的执行时间相关的知识,希望对你有一定的参考价值。

计算程序中某一个函数或算法的执行时间

#include <stdio.h>
#include <time.h>
#include <stdlib.h>

int main()
{
    long i = 10000000L;
    clock_t start, finish;
    double duration;
    printf( "Time to do %ld empty loops is ", i) ;
    start = clock();
    while( i-- );
    finish = clock();
    duration = (double)(finish - start) / CLOCKS_PER_SEC;
    printf( "%f seconds\n", duration );
    return 0;
}

以上是关于C语言计算程序中某一个函数或算法的执行时间的主要内容,如果未能解决你的问题,请参考以下文章

怎样计算程序的执行时间(C语言中)?

c语言进阶5-递归算法

求2011年九月以及以前的计算机二级考试C语言试题及答案、以及考试内容分析和解题技巧。记住只要C的。

#yyds干货盘点#愚公系列2023年02月 .NET/C#知识点-程序运行计时的总结

C语言中的函数要点(下)

C语言里的system函数都有啥用